Owensville adopts RecDesk parks-management agreement

City of Owensville Board of Aldermen · November 3, 2025

The Board of Aldermen voted unanimously to adopt Ordinance No. 1491, authorizing Mayor Kevin McFadden to sign a parks and recreation management software agreement with RecDesk LLC.

The Board of Aldermen voted to adopt Bill No. 2025‑28 as Ordinance No. 1491, authorizing Mayor Kevin McFadden to execute a parks and recreation management software agreement with RecDesk LLC.

Alderman Bohl moved for a second reading and, after a second reading and a motion by Alderman Lahmeyer to place the bill on final passage, the roll call was recorded with Aldermen Bohl, Kramme, Breeden and Lahmeyer voting aye. The mayor asked, “Shall Bill No 2025‑28 become Ordinance No 1491?” and the motion carried. The ordinance establishes the city's authority to enter the RecDesk agreement and sets the effective date in the ordinance text.
